May Christ Be Great, Not Us!

Spurgeon wrote:
Young person, seeking great things for yourself, Christ counsels, "Do not seek them."  I remember that as a young man I was ambitious.  I was seeking to go to college, to leave my congregation in the wilderness that I might become something great.  As I was out walking, this text came with power to my heart, "Do you seek great things for yourself?  Do not seek them" (Jer. 45:5).  "Lord," I said, "I will follow Your counsel and not my own plans."  I have never had cause to regret that decision.  Always take the Lord for your guide, and you will never be wrong.
Charles Spurgeon, Beside Still Waters, Ed. Roy Clarke (Nashville:  Thomas Nelson, 1999), 361.
